Registers 6989 - 6994 and 6996 - 6998 are general information registers. Register 6995 is used to indicate a calibration
alarm from the Encal 3000, and register 3103 is used to indicate a security alarm from the Encal 3000.
The order of the variables in the modbus listings of the Encal 3000 must match the order of the components found in the
“Encal Component Codes” tab of the Model 2000 Configuration Software. This allows for quick and easy changing of one or
many components.
Depending on the stream number read at location 6997, the Encal will read the corresponding streams gas data. Stream 1’s
data can be found at addresses 7000 - 7024, stream 2 from 7200 - 7224, stream 3 from 7300 - 7324 up to stream 6 at 7600 -
7624.
